The Role of Garden Designers

Garden designers are the creative minds behind the stunning outdoor spaces that grace homes and public areas. They combine artistic vision with practical knowledge to create gardens that are not only aesthetically pleasing but also sustainable and functional. In Little Lever, garden designers work closely with clients to understand their needs, preferences, and the unique characteristics of their outdoor spaces. This collaborative process ensures that each garden is a true reflection of its owner's personality and lifestyle.

Understanding Client Needs

One of the most important aspects of a garden designer's job is understanding the client's needs and desires. This involves discussing the purpose of the garden, whether it's for relaxation, entertainment, or growing vegetables. Designers also consider the client's budget, maintenance preferences, and any specific features they wish to include, such as water features, patios, or play areas for children.

Site Analysis and Planning

Before any design work begins, garden designers conduct a thorough site analysis. This involves assessing the soil quality, drainage, sunlight exposure, and existing vegetation. Understanding these factors is crucial for creating a garden that thrives in its environment. Designers also take into account the architectural style of the home and the surrounding landscape to ensure a harmonious design.

Design Principles and Techniques

Garden designers in Little Lever employ a range of design principles and techniques to create visually appealing and functional gardens. These principles guide the layout, plant selection, and overall aesthetic of the garden, ensuring a cohesive and balanced design.

Unity and Harmony

Unity and harmony are essential principles in garden design. They ensure that all elements of the garden work together to create a cohesive look. Designers achieve this by using a consistent style, colour palette, and plant selection throughout the garden. This creates a sense of continuity and balance, making the garden feel like a natural extension of the home.

Proportion and Scale

Proportion and scale are crucial for creating a balanced garden. Designers carefully consider the size of plants, structures, and features in relation to the overall space. This ensures that no element overwhelms the garden, and everything is in harmony. For example, a small garden may benefit from compact plants and features, while a larger space can accommodate more substantial elements.

Focal Points and Accents

Focal points and accents draw the eye and add interest to a garden. Designers use these elements to create visual interest and guide the viewer's gaze. Common focal points include sculptures, water features, or a striking plant. Accents, such as colourful flowers or unique textures, add depth and variety to the garden.

Plant Selection and Sustainability

Choosing the right plants is a critical aspect of garden design. In Little Lever, designers select plants that thrive in the local climate and soil conditions, ensuring a sustainable and low-maintenance garden.

Native and Drought-Tolerant Plants

Native plants are well-suited to the local environment and require less water and maintenance. Garden designers often incorporate these plants into their designs to create sustainable gardens that support local wildlife. Drought-tolerant plants are also popular choices, as they can withstand dry spells and reduce the need for irrigation.

Seasonal Interest

To keep a garden looking vibrant year-round, designers select plants that offer seasonal interest. This includes choosing plants with different blooming periods, foliage colours, and textures. By incorporating a variety of plants, designers ensure that the garden remains visually appealing throughout the year.

Hardscaping and Garden Features

Hardscaping refers to the non-plant elements of a garden, such as paths, patios, and walls. These features add structure and functionality to a garden, creating spaces for relaxation, entertainment, and movement.

Pathways and Patios

Pathways and patios are essential components of a well-designed garden. They provide access and define different areas within the garden. Designers choose materials that complement the overall design, such as natural stone, gravel, or brick. These materials add texture and interest to the garden while ensuring durability and ease of maintenance.

Water Features

Water features, such as ponds, fountains, and waterfalls, add a sense of tranquillity and movement to a garden. They create a soothing atmosphere and attract wildlife, enhancing the garden's biodiversity. Designers carefully consider the placement and scale of water features to ensure they integrate seamlessly into the overall design.

Lighting and Ambiance

Lighting plays a crucial role in enhancing the ambiance and functionality of a garden. It extends the usability of outdoor spaces into the evening and highlights key features of the garden.

Functional Lighting

Functional lighting ensures that pathways, patios, and other areas are safe and accessible after dark. Designers use a combination of overhead lights, bollards, and step lights to illuminate these areas effectively. This type of lighting is both practical and stylish, enhancing the garden's overall design.

Accent Lighting

Accent lighting highlights specific features of the garden, such as sculptures, water features, or architectural elements. Designers use spotlights, uplights, and downlights to create dramatic effects and draw attention to these focal points. This type of lighting adds depth and interest to the garden, creating a magical atmosphere.

Garden Maintenance and Care

Once a garden is designed and installed, ongoing maintenance is essential to keep it looking its best. Garden designers in Little Lever often provide maintenance plans and services to ensure the longevity and health of the garden.

Regular Pruning and Trimming

Pruning and trimming are essential tasks for maintaining the shape and health of plants. Regular pruning encourages new growth, removes dead or diseased branches, and prevents plants from becoming overgrown. Designers provide guidance on the best practices for pruning different types of plants, ensuring they thrive in the garden.

Soil Health and Fertilisation

Healthy soil is the foundation of a thriving garden. Designers recommend regular soil testing and amendments to maintain optimal soil conditions. This may include adding organic matter, such as compost, and using appropriate fertilisers to provide essential nutrients for plant growth.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is the average cost of hiring a garden designer in Little Lever? The cost varies depending on the size and complexity of the project. It's best to request quotes from multiple designers to compare prices and services.
  • How long does it take to design and install a garden? The timeline depends on the project's scope and the designer's schedule. On average, it can take several weeks to a few months from initial consultation to completion.
  • Can garden designers work with existing gardens? Yes, designers can enhance and revitalise existing gardens by incorporating new elements and improving layout and plant selection.
  • Do garden designers provide maintenance services? Many designers offer maintenance services or can recommend trusted professionals to ensure the garden remains healthy and beautiful.
  • What should I prepare for the initial consultation with a garden designer? Prepare a list of your preferences, budget, and any specific features you want. Photos of your current garden and inspiration images can also be helpful.
  • Are there sustainable garden design options available? Absolutely! Designers can incorporate eco-friendly practices, such as using native plants, rainwater harvesting, and organic gardening techniques.
